Magnera Announces Participation in the 2025 Bank of America Leveraged Finance Conference
CHARLOTTE, N.C., Nov. 24, 2025 ( GLOBE NEWSWIRE ) -- Magnera Corporation ( NYSE: MAGN ) today announced it will participate in the 2025 Bank of America Leveraged Finance Conference. Magnera CEO, Curt Begle, CFO, Jim Till, and EVP, Corporate Development, Investor Relations & Strategy, Robert ...
